Output 6c039f5b1b84ad9f7656ac6a8954743df03c8df73dc3c830d364069087070968:0

value
26040310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20b3dc3a5bc83f192eba52591c5d351a4a7e2125 OP_EQUAL
address
34fw1bKxRBkpUSSb1UpS8vA13iHTVvx9g9
transaction
6c039f5b1b84ad9f7656ac6a8954743df03c8df73dc3c830d364069087070968
spent
true